Capacity note for the Bramblewick export retry queue. Failed exports are requeued with exponential backoff, and the queue depth is our main capacity signal: sustained depth above the high-water mark means downstream Pellis storage is saturated, not that we need more workers. As the new contractor, please don't raise worker counts without checking storage latency first — it usually makes things worse. Retry timing, backoff caps, and the high-water threshold are all driven by the constants shown below.

limits module of yagef-bajog:
TIERS = {
    "druael": 370,
    "tamix": 286,
    "pelius": 541,
    "pelael": 78,
    "pelox": 47,
    "ralath": 533,
    "drumir": 801,
}

Subject: Welcome to on-call — currency rounding gotchas

Hi, and welcome to the Pennywhistle on-call rotation! One thing that'll hit you in week one: support tickets about totals being "off by a cent." It's almost always our currency conversion rounding — we convert at line-item level, round half-even, then sum, so totals can differ from converting the sum directly. It's by design, not a bug, but customers don't love it. Before escalating, check the ticket against the standard explanations and known edge cases on the internal page.

runbook for badug-kadup: https://confluence.zemvarlabs.internal/projects/browse/display/projects/bd1b

Step 7 covers enabling Memtrace-GX, our GPU memory profiler, on the Quillhaven inference cluster. Please verify the sampler interval stays at 250ms, since lower values distort allocation timelines. The profiler uploads snapshots to the Orveth archive, which requires authentication. After the existing exporter settings in the env file, insert the line defining the upload token.

vault entry, tawep-bagef: COURIER_KEY3=5a5

Ticket: DEDUP-412 — Connection failures during customer record dedup

The Larkspur dedup job started failing overnight with pool exhaustion errors. It merges duplicate customer records in batches of 500, but the batch worker isn't releasing connections after a merge conflict, so the pool drains within twenty minutes. Proposed fix: wrap merges in a try/finally release and cap retries at three. For the sync, reproduce against staging using the connection string below.

primary connection of bagep-kaweg = clickhouse://rusdor_svc:3TXlgH7O8DuUYI@db-ae3f.zarqelgrid.internal:5432/zordor